Job description

Radiation Therapists are highly-skilled clinicians and integral to the radiation oncology team. They are responsible for ensuring that treatments are accurate and match the treatment prescribed by radiation oncologists. Radiation therapists assist in the use of linear accelerators, CT scanners and X-Ray films to localize and treat anatomical structures. They ensure the precise setup of patients to minimize dose delivery to surrounding structures. They maintain constant visual and verbal contact with patients throughout treatment, ensuring safe delivery. They educate patients about their treatments and simulation procedures, monitoring patient progress throughout the course of treatment. They also ensure accurate and thorough documentation in hospital medical records systems. The Radiation Therapist I position is for therapists with less than 4 years of experience working in the radiation therapy field.
